Manulife and Kenedix Launch $170M Japan Multi-Family JV With 9 Seed Assets

2022/03/06 by Christopher Caillavet Leave a Comment

Canada’s Manulife Investment Management and Tokyo-based Kenedix have agreed to form a JPY 19.8 billion ($170 million) joint venture to acquire multi-family assets in Japan’s major cities.

HKRI Selling Tokyo Multi-Family Assets for $30M

2022/02/20 by Christopher Caillavet Leave a Comment

Hong Kong developer HKR International has agreed to sell two Tokyo residential buildings for JPY 3.49 billion ($30 million), adding to a string of recent property disposals by HKRI in Japan.

AEW Picks Up Set of Four Greater Tokyo Multi-Family Buildings

2022/01/18 by Christopher Caillavet Leave a Comment

AEW Capital Management has acquired a portfolio of four newly completed residential buildings with a combined 177 units in Greater Tokyo, signalling conviction in multi-family as one of the firm’s key investment themes in Asia.
